Ciza joins the march against GBV, calls for men's accountability

South African artist Ciza participated in a nationwide demonstration opposing gender-based violence, sharing footage of himself marching among thousands dressed in black. The musician emphasized that violent abuse has devastated countless families across the nation, with numerous mothers, sisters, friends and relatives lost to the epidemic.

Ciza stressed that men must actively challenge the cultural conditions enabling such violence and urged male communities to maintain accountability. He expressed hope for collective healing from trauma while advocating for improved safety across South Africa.

His involvement coincides with intensified activism addressing the country's severe GBV statistics, as demonstrations spread through major metropolitan areas and citizens demand official recognition of the crisis as a national emergency through widespread social media campaigns.
